Abstract
This paper analyses the impact of the high penetration of electric vehicles (EVs) charging loads on the thermal ageing of distribution transformers of an isolated electric grid in a Portuguese Island. In this paper, a transformer thermal model is used to estimate the hot-spot temperature (θh) given the load ratio. Real data are used for the main inputs of the model, i.e. residential load, transformer parameters, time-of-use rates and electric vehicle parameters. Conclusions are duly drawn.
